在数学的奇妙世界里,欧拉定理是一个让人着迷的定理。它揭示了整数指数幂和同余运算之间的深刻联系。即使是对数学只有初步了解的小学生,也能通过一些简单的技巧来理解并运用欧拉定理。下面,我们就来揭开欧拉定理的神秘面纱,看看如何用小学数学的知识轻松破解它的难题。
欧拉定理简介
欧拉定理是数论中的一个基本定理,它说明了对于任何整数 (a) 和一个与 (a) 互质的正整数 (n),(a^{\phi(n)} \equiv 1 \pmod{n}),其中 (\phi(n)) 是欧拉函数,表示小于 (n) 且与 (n) 互质的正整数的个数。
理解欧拉函数
欧拉函数 (\phi(n)) 的计算方法是通过将 (n) 分解成质因数的乘积,然后从每个质因数的指数中减去 1,再将这些结果相乘。例如,对于 (n = 12),它的质因数分解是 (2^2 \times 3),所以 (\phi(12) = (2-1) \times (2-1) \times (3-1) = 2 \times 2 \times 2 = 8)。
举例说明
为了更好地理解欧拉定理,我们可以通过一个简单的例子来说明:
假设我们想要计算 (3^5 \mod 7)。首先,我们需要找到 7 的欧拉函数 (\phi(7))。由于 7 是质数,所以 (\phi(7) = 7 - 1 = 6)。
根据欧拉定理,我们有 (3^6 \equiv 1 \pmod{7})。这意味着 (3^6) 除以 7 的余数是 1。现在我们可以利用这个结果来计算 (3^5 \mod 7):
[ 3^5 \mod 7 = (3^6 \times 3^{-1}) \mod 7 ] [ \equiv 1 \times 3^{-1} \mod 7 ]
为了找到 (3^{-1} \mod 7),我们需要找到一个数 (x),使得 (3x \equiv 1 \pmod{7})。通过尝试,我们发现 (x = 5),因为 (3 \times 5 = 15 \equiv 1 \pmod{7})。
所以,(3^5 \mod 7 = 1 \times 5 \mod 7 = 5)。
应用欧拉定理
欧拉定理在密码学、计算机科学和数学的其他领域都有广泛的应用。例如,它可以用来快速计算大数的幂模运算,这在加密算法中非常重要。
小学数学的启示
欧拉定理虽然看起来很复杂,但其实它只是一种数学规律。通过分解质因数和简单的乘除运算,我们就可以计算出欧拉函数,并应用欧拉定理来解决问题。这对于小学生来说是一个很好的数学实践,它不仅能够加深对数学概念的理解,还能培养逻辑思维和解决问题的能力。
总之,欧拉定理是一个既神秘又有趣的概念,即使是小学数学的学生也能通过简单的技巧来掌握它。通过不断地练习和应用,我们可以更好地理解数学的美妙,并享受到破解数学难题的乐趣。
